Measurements of the branching fraction ratio B(ϕ → µ +µ −)/B(ϕ → e +e −) with D+ s → π +ϕ and D+ → π +ϕ decays, denoted Rs ϕπ and Rd ϕπ, are presented. The analysis is performed using a dataset corresponding to an integrated luminosity of 5.4 fb−1 of pp collision data collected with the LHCb experiment. The branching fractions are normalised with respect to the B+ → K+J/ψ(→ e +e −) and B+ → K+J/ψ(→ µ +µ −) decay modes. The combination of the results yields Rϕπ = 1.022 ± 0.012 (stat) ± 0.048 (syst). The result is compatible with previous measurements of the ϕ → ℓ +ℓ − branching fractions and predictions based on the Standard Model.
